THE GARAND COLLECTORS ASSOCIATION INC, founded in 2001, is a small nonprofit in the Recreation & Sports sector that reported $835K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ue grew 15%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. The organization ran a surplus of $149K, a strong 18% operating margin.

Mission

TO EXCHANGE INFORMATION AND EXPAND KNOWLEDGE OF THE U.S. RIFLE, CALIBER .30, M1
